WebOct 31, 2024 · The heating output per m 2 can be adjusted by varying the cable spacing to achieve your desired heating output. In-screed electric heating systems take longer to install compared with electric underfloor heating mats, so we would recommend using a pre-spaced fixing profile for an easier and more secure cable installation. WebThe free flowing Topflow Screed A will encapsulate the heating pipes without leaving any voids. The heat transfers through the screed, therefore maximising the thermal conductivity of the floor making it an efficient and cost saving screed system.
